How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 88.16 against 87.43 in East Timor, a difference of 0.73.
Across all 23 years both countries report, Bangladesh has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 168th and East Timor ranks 170th of 225 countries.
Bangladesh has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| East Timor |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 49.33 | 33.31 | 16.02 | Bangladesh |
| 2010s | 68.99 | 60.07 | 8.92 | Bangladesh |
| 2020s | 84.27 | 81.75 | 2.52 | Bangladesh |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
